"In case you haven't noticed, Yahoo pretty much sucks.  I get two or three
bogus emails from legitimate email accounts every week and am getting tired
of it.  So will all of you with Yahoo accounts either drop their sorry butts
or at the very least change your passwords to something with at least eight
characters in it, that contains an uppercase and a lowercase letter, a
number AND a special character such as anything along the top row of your
keyboard!?  Do not, I repeat, do NOT make a password that is a common word
found in the dictionary.  Don't make your password, for example, fred123 or
hornet or javabc.
